Ville Karavirta
Ville Karavirta
Previously a researcher at Aalto University and University of Turku
Verified email at - Homepage
Cited by
Cited by
Review of recent systems for automatic assessment of programming assignments
P Ihantola, T Ahoniemi, V Karavirta, O Seppälä
Proceedings of the 10th Koli Calling International Conference on Computing …, 2010
A review of generic program visualization systems for introductory programming education
J Sorva, V Karavirta, L Malmi
ACM Transactions on Computing Education (TOCE) 13 (4), 1-64, 2013
Visual algorithm simulation exercise system with automatic assessment: TRAKLA2
L Malmi, V Karavirta, A Korhonen, J Nikander, O Seppälä, P Silvasti
Informatics in Education 3 (2), 267-288, 2004
MatrixPro-A tool for on-the-fly demonstration of data structures and algorithms
V Karavirta, A Korhonen, L Malmi, K Stålnacke
Proceedings of the Third Program Visualization Workshop, 26-33, 2004
Experiences on automatically assessed algorithm simulation exercises with different resubmission policies
L Malmi, V Karavirta, A Korhonen, J Nikander
Journal on Educational Resources in Computing (JERIC) 5 (3), 7, 2005
How do students solve parsons programming problems?: an analysis of interaction traces
J Helminen, P Ihantola, V Karavirta, L Malmi
Proceedings of the ninth annual international conference on International …, 2012
Design and architecture of an interactive eTextbook–The OpenDSA system
E Fouh, V Karavirta, DA Breakiron, S Hamouda, S Hall, TL Naps, ...
Science of Computer Programming 88, 22-40, 2014
JSAV: the JavaScript algorithm visualization library
V Karavirta, CA Shaffer
Proceedings of the 18th ACM conference on Innovation and technology in …, 2013
Two-dimensional parson’s puzzles: The concept, tools, and first observations
P Ihantola, V Karavirta
Journal of Information Technology Education 10 (2), 119-132, 2011
Merging interactive visualizations with hypertextbooks and course management
G Rößling, T Naps, MS Hall, V Karavirta, A Kerren, C Leska, A Moreno, ...
ACM SIGCSE Bulletin 38 (4), 166-181, 2006
Taxonomy of effortless creation of algorithm visualizations
P Ihantola, V Karavirta, A Korhonen, J Nikander
Proceedings of the first international workshop on Computing education …, 2005
OpenDSA: beginning a community active-eBook project
CA Shaffer, V Karavirta, A Korhonen, TL Naps
Proceedings of the 11th Koli Calling International Conference on Computing …, 2011
Service-oriented approach to improve interoperability of e-learning systems
V Karavirta, P Ihantola, T Koskinen
2013 IEEE 13th International Conference on Advanced Learning Technologies …, 2013
On the use of resubmissions in automatic assessment systems
V Karavirta, A Korhonen, L Malmi
Computer science education 16 (3), 229-240, 2006
A Mobile Learning Application for Parsons Problems with Automatic Feedback
V Karavirta, J Helminen, P Ihantola
12th Koli Calling International Conference on Computing Education Research …, 2012
Recording and analyzing in-browser programming sessions
J Helminen, P Ihantola, V Karavirta
Proceedings of the 13th Koli Calling International Conference on Computing …, 2013
MatrixPro - A tool for demonstrating data structures and algorithms ex tempore
V Karavirta, A Korhonen, L Malmi, K Stålnacke
Advanced Learning Technologies, 2004. Proceedings. IEEE International …, 2004
How to study programming on mobile touch devices: interactive Python code exercises
P Ihantola, J Helminen, V Karavirta
Proceedings of the 13th Koli Calling International Conference on Computing …, 2013
Quality Of WordPress Plug-Ins: An Overview of Security and User Ratings
T Koskinen, P Ihantola, V Karavirta
Third International Workshop on Security and Privacy in Social Networks, 2012
Requirements and design strategies for open source interactive computer science eBooks
A Korhonen, T Naps, C Boisvert, P Crescenzi, V Karavirta, L Mannila, ...
Proceedings of the ITiCSE working group reports conference on Innovation and …, 2013
The system can't perform the operation now. Try again later.
Articles 1–20